A visual cat compendium that redefines what it means to be a "cat lady," showcasing various influential women and their feline friends.
For New York City fashion and beauty photographer BriAnne Wills, the
"crazy cat lady" is a myth. Co-written with Elyse Moody, senior editor
at Martha Stewart Living, this book redefines the stereotype by
showcasing 50 strong, independent, and artistic women who take the
world in stride, flanked by their beloved felines. With its vibrant
cover and gorgeous faux-suede spine, Girls and Their Cats
features striking portraits and engaging profiles of each woman and her
cat—or cats—including fun facts unique to each furry friend.



Girls include:

• Hannah Shaw, humane educator, animal advocate, and founder of the neonatal kitten rescue project Kitten Lady

• Christene Barberich, cofounder of Refinery29

• Alyssa Mastromonaco, author, Crooked Media podcast host, and reproductive rights activist

• Maria Hinojosa, anchor and executive producer of NPR's Latino USA

• Nikki Garcia, owner and designer of the clothing line First Rite

• Erica Chidi Cohen, doula, author, and cofounder of the reproductive health education company Loom

• Anka Lavriv, tattoo artist and co-owner of Black Iris Tattoo



Interspersed
throughout are amusing lists any cat lady will find relatable, from
"How to Catproof Your Home" to "The Chorus of Cat Sounds," as well as an
adoption resource guide and a list of rescue organizations in the
United States and Canada.



This irresistible book celebrates the
powerful bond between a girl and her cat, proving that we need them just
as much as they need us.

BriAnne Wills is a fashion and beauty photographer in New York. She graduated from the University of Oregon in 2007 with a degree in journalism, but quickly discovered her passion for storytelling through photography. After four years in China, the Czech Republic, and Ukraine, BriAnne moved to Brooklyn in 2014 with her husband and two rescue cats from Kiev (Tucker a.k.a. Tuck, and Liza) to pursue fashion photography. Her work has been published in Teen Vogue, Nylon, Spin, Italian Vogue, and ELLE, and her clients include Refinery29, Wildfang, Milk Makeup, Buxom Cosmetics, Maybelline, Shiseido, and The Coveteur. Teen Vogue commissioned BriAnne to shoot a “Cats and Cat Eyes” beauty editorial inspired by her photo series.
